# Nobody Has Counted the Back Row of the Lumber Yard Since March. A Drone Does It Before the 6 a.m. Loader.

> Phantom on-hand in BisTrack costs a building products dealer orders every week. Autonomous drone counts read bundle tags before the yard starts moving.

Eleven units of 2x10 are on the books. Nine are on the ground. Nobody knows when the other two left, and the yard foreman is not going to find out on a Tuesday in July with four deliveries staged and aforklift down.

That gap is not theft in most yards. It is a bundle that got broken for a will-call pull and never adjusted, a lift that went out on a delivery ticket somebody signed and nobody closed, and a tally that was written in the rain. It costs you twice: once as an inventory adjustment in January, and once every week when a counter rep promises material that the system says is there and the driver cannot find.

## The physical count you schedule, and then keep not doing

Every building products dealer and millwork distributor has the same paper plan. Cycle counts weekly by row. Full physical count at year end for the accountants, with the CPA standing in the yard watching somebody read tags off banded lifts. In practice the cycle counts survive January and February, and then March arrives, the build season starts, and every hour of yard labor goes to loading trucks.

The back row is the worst of it. The cantilever rack against the fence with the 5/4 decking, the covered shed with the pre-primed trim, the units of prefinished plywood that have been under wrap since the price ran up. Those are the pieces nobody walks unless there is a reason, which means they are exactly the pieces where the on-hand quantity in Epicor BisTrack or DMSi Agility drifts furthest from reality.

**An autonomous inspection flight is a drone or ground robot that walks the same route your yard foreman would walk, reads the bundle and unit tags, counts what is physically there, and hands back a variance list against your on-hand quantities, without needing a person to give up a Saturday.**

## What changed: the walk-around went from a pilot project to a production job

Through 2024 and 2025 this was a trade show item. Somebody flew a drone in a warehouse, it read some tags, everybody clapped, and it never became part of the week. In 2026 it became routine work. Hyundai put AI-powered autonomous drones into inspection duty at its Georgia plant and cut inspection time by roughly 90 percent. Humanoid platforms moved out of demonstration videos and into real facilities doing real rounds.

Two things made that possible for a yard your size. The flight no longer needs a pilot standing there with a controller, and the reading no longer needs a perfect barcode square to the camera. It handles a weathered tag, a tag half under a band, a tag at an angle across a row.

## The 5:30 a.m. flight, and what lands on the foreman's tablet

```mermaid
flowchart LR
  A["5:30am flight over the yard and shed"] --> B["Reads bundle and unit tags row by row"]
  B --> C["Counts units, flags broken bands and torn wrap"]
  C --> D["Compares against on-hand in BisTrack"]
  D --> E{"Variance greater than 2 units?"}
  E -->|Yes| F["Recount list on the yard foreman's tablet at 6:15"]
  E -->|No| G["Pass logged, nothing for anyone to do"]
```

The flight happens before the first loader turns over, which matters more than it sounds. You cannot count a yard that is moving. At 5:30 nothing has been pulled yet, so what the drone sees is the true opening position for the day. By 6:15 the foreman has a list of nine locations to eyeball, not four thousand tags to read.

The second output is the one people forget to ask for: damage and condition. Wrap torn open on a unit of prefinished panel that has been rained on. A band broken on hip and valley material. Water pooling on the flat of a covered lift. Those cost you in returns and in claims, and they are invisible until a customer opens the bundle at their job site.

## The rack inspection you are already supposed to be doing

Here is the part that turns this from a nice-to-have into something your insurance carrier cares about. Your pallet and cantilever racking is supposed to be inspected on a schedule, damaged uprights tagged and unloaded, and the inspection documented. The industry standard for racking inspection and the general duty obligation to keep the place safe both point the same direction, and a forklift strike on a column base is exactly the kind of damage that gets noticed after the row comes down rather than before.

Nobody in a 22-person yard operation is walking every upright with a clipboard every month during build season. A flight that photographs every column base at the same angle every week, and flags the ones that changed, gives you both the inspection record and the early warning. When your carrier's loss control person shows up, you have dated images of every bay instead of a form somebody filled out from memory.

## Running the numbers honestly, including the part where it does not pay

Assumptions, all illustrative. Yard and shed carry $2.4 million in inventory across roughly 4,200 tagged bundles and units. You do a full physical count twice a year: five people, seven hours, Saturday overtime, call it $34 an hour fully loaded. Annual inventory adjustment runs 1.1 percent.

| Two full counts a year, 70 labor hours | $2,380 |
| --- | --- |
| Annual inventory adjustment at 1.1 percent of $2.4M | $26,400 |
| If weekly flights cut that adjustment by a third | $8,700 saved |
| Counting hours moved back to loading trucks | $2,000 |
| **Subtotal from counting and shrink** | **$10,700** |
| Program cost at $1,800 a month | $21,600 |

On those two lines it loses. Say that out loud before somebody in your family says it for you. The line that carries it is the third one: orders promised on quantities that are not there. Suppose three orders a week get committed against phantom on-hand. Each one becomes a hot-shot buy at dealer cost, a late delivery on a framing crew's morning, or a lost sale to the yard across town. Put $180 of margin and goodwill on each, and that is $28,000 a year. Now the arithmetic works, and it works for a reason you can actually verify: count how many times last month your counter promised something the driver could not find.

## Where the drone is useless and a person is not

It counts units. It does not grade lumber. Nobody should be making a grade or moisture call from a photograph of a banded lift, and if your business turns on grade, that stays with your buyer and your yard foreman.

It struggles with anything not tagged, anything loose, and anything inside. Cull piles, remnants, returns waiting to be put away, and the pile of odd lengths behind the saw shed are going to stay a human problem. So is the millwork warehouse when it is packed floor to ceiling in October, because a drone needs aisle to fly and you have not had aisle since August.

Weather takes flights away from you in exactly the season you want them. Wind, driving rain and ice all ground it. Plan on a count cadence that survives a two-week gap in February.

And it will not fix a process problem. If broken bundles are not being adjusted at the point of the pull, the drone will find the same variance every week forever. The report is only worth what your foreman does with it by 7 a.m.

## Frequently asked questions

### Do I need to re-tag the whole yard first?

Usually not the whole yard, but expect to re-tag the worst rows. If a tag has faded to nothing or is buried under a band, no reader is getting it. Budget a week of yard labor for tags before the first real flight, and treat it as inventory hygiene you owed yourself anyway.

### Can it count inside the millwork warehouse, not just the yard?

Indoors works, and ground robots often work better than flying ones in a door warehouse where you have narrow aisles and pre-hung units racked high. The constraint is aisle width and clutter, not the technology. Yards with a covered shed usually get both.

### Our on-hand quantities in BisTrack are already wrong. Does this make that worse?

It makes it visible, which for about six weeks feels worse. The first few flights will produce a variance list long enough to be discouraging. Work it down row by row rather than trying to reconcile everything at once, and do not adjust anything in the system without a human recount of that specific location.

### What does my insurance carrier think of this?

Talk to them before you buy. Several carriers now look favorably on documented, dated rack and housekeeping inspection records, and a weekly photographic record of every bay is a stronger record than a monthly checklist. Ask specifically whether it affects your loss control rating.
